Takeover tussle: L&T’s takeover bid fails to unsettle Mindtree

Even as Larsen and Toubro (L&T) on Tuesday tried to play down the nature of its move to take over technology firm Mindtree, promoters of the latter refused to budge from their stand, terming the move hostile, unprecedented, and unexplainable. They maintained that the culture of the two companies are not aligned.

Addressing newspersons on Tuesday, L&T MD & CEO SN Subrahmanyan said what they are trying to do is with pyaar (love) and will continue to look at it as something they are doing from dil (heart).

He was speaking a day after L&T announced that it has entered into a definitive share purchase agreement (SPA) with VG Siddhartha and his related entities — Coffee Day Trading and Coffee Day Enterprises — to acquire 20.32% stake in Mindtree at `980 per share, aggregating to approximately `3,269 crore, and stating their intention to acquire up to 15% of the share capital in on-market purchase and make a further open offer of 31% for `980 a piece respectively, valuing the total transaction at about `10,700 crore.
